Chicago Women Plan Fete for Mrs. Wise April 26 at Hotel

April 17, 1934
See Original Daily Bulletin From This Date

Women’s clubs and organizations of Chicago are planning a luncheon in honor of Mrs. Louise Waterman Wise, wife of Rabbi Stephen S. Wise of New York, to be held on April 26 at the Stevens Hotel.

Invitations have been sent to Jewish women’s organizations and clubs of the city to attend the luncheon, which will be given under the auspices of the Chicago Committee of the American Jewish Congress. The active committee in charge includes Mrs. Claude A. Benjamin and Mrs. Jack Bernstein, co-chairmen, Mrs. Harry Berkman, Miss Pearl Franklin, Mrs. B. L. Goldberg, Mrs. Philip Grossman, Mr. Frederick Kahn, Mrs. Nat Kahn, Mrs. A. J. Perlman and Mr. and Mrs. S. E. Steinberg.
